Cedar Valley High vs Summit High
Cedar Valley High has a higher overall rating of 6.4/10 compared to 5.9/10. Cedar Valley High is significantly larger with 3,190 students, about 29.5× the size of Summit High (108). In math proficiency, Cedar Valley High leads at 22.0%.
